Incredible Motion Experience
The Omni One provides complete 360-degree freedom of movement, including walking, squatting, kneeling, and jumping. This freedom of movement is ideal for applications in training, education, healthcare, and the design industry.
Thanks to advanced motion separation technologies, Omni One delivers an incredibly realistic walking experience. Motion data for the head, hands, and feet are recorded separately, allowing you to move naturally and independently in your virtual environment.
Unlimited SDK Access
Integrate the Omni One seamlessly with Unity, Unreal Engine, and SteamVR controller bindings. This allows you to create custom applications and experiences that perfectly meet your business needs.
For applications with the standalone Pico 4 Enterprise headset, Omni One provides an SDK that ensures compatibility with the headset operating system.
Compact and Mobile
With a compact design of just 1.2 metres in diameter and easy, tool-less assembly, the Omni One is quick to set up and easy to move thanks to built-in wheels. Ideal for a variety of workspaces.
Flexible and User-friendly
The Omni One is designed to support a wide range of users, with adjustable modifications for heights from 132 cm to 192 cm and weights up to 113 kg. The system includes variable adjustable arm resistance and three sizes of overshoes for a comfortable fit.
The adjustable support vest and sturdy aluminium arm ensure safe navigation in the virtual world, without the risk of collisions.
Frequently Asked Questions
Which VR headsets are compatible with the Omni One Enterprise?
You can connect the Omni One to a PC via Bluetooth and use any PCVR headset, such as models from Meta, HTC, or Pico. Additionally, you can opt for the custom standalone Pico 4 Enterprise headset (sold separately).
What movements can the Omni One track?
The Omni One tracks natural movements such as walking, turning, squatting, and more. Thanks to three-axis separation technology, the head, hands, and feet move independently for a seamless and immersive VR experience.
How do I integrate the Omni One into my application?
Use Omni Connect to connect the Omni One treadmill to a PC (Windows) via Bluetooth. For standalone applications with the Pico 4 Enterprise headset, you can use the Unity or Unreal Engine SDK.
Is the Omni One suitable for commercial entertainment venues?
No, the Omni One Enterprise is not designed for use in entertainment centres. Please see the Omni Arena for this.
Which games can I play on the Omni One?
The Omni One Enterprise is designed for developers who can create their own games via the available SDK. Additionally, there is an app store with compatible games if you use the Omni One with the optional customised Pico 4 Enterprise. Discover the selection here:
